Angle Aluminum Profile Sourcing Guide

Buyers evaluating angle aluminum profiles must first distinguish between standard extruded shapes and custom-engineered solutions tailored for specific structural loads. The market offers a diverse range of alloys, primarily from the 6000 series, which includes 6063 and 6061 grades known for their excellent extrudability and corrosion resistance. These materials are frequently utilized in window and door frames, glass wall systems, and decorative architectural elements where both strength and aesthetic finish are critical.

Procurement decisions should also account for the specific temper requirements, which typically range from T3 to T8 depending on the intended application. While some profiles are designed for general decoration, others intended for transportation tools or heavy-duty heat sinks require higher temper states to ensure dimensional stability under stress. Understanding these material distinctions is essential before engaging with suppliers to ensure the selected profile meets the mechanical demands of the final assembly.

Technical Specifications to Verify

Technical verification must begin with the alloy composition, as the 6000 series provides a balance of strength and formability suitable for most construction and industrial uses. Buyers should confirm whether the supplier provides 6063 or 6061 alloys, as the former is preferred for architectural applications requiring smooth anodizing, while the latter offers higher strength for structural components. The temper designation, such as T3 through T8, must be explicitly stated to ensure the material possesses the necessary yield strength for the specific load-bearing application.

Surface treatment specifications are equally critical, with options ranging from mechanical polishing to chemical polishing and various anodic oxidation processes. The choice between powder spraying and anodizing affects the final product's resistance to UV exposure and chemical corrosion, which is vital for long-term performance in harsh environments. Additionally, the length specifications, typically capped at eight meters, must be validated against shipping constraints and on-site installation requirements to avoid unnecessary cutting or jointing that could compromise structural integrity.

FAQs

What alloys are typically used for angle aluminum profile extrusions?

Angle aluminum profile is commonly extruded from 6000 series alloys, with 6063 and 6061 being the materials most frequently listed for structural and decorative uses. 6063 suits window, door, and decoration applications, while 6061 offers higher strength for transport and load-bearing uses. Tempers such as T3 to T8 are available depending on the application.

Which surface finishes can be applied to angle aluminum profile?

Listed surface options include mill finish, anodizing, anodic oxidation, powder coating, powder spraying, and chemical or mechanical polishing. Anodizing provides corrosion resistance, while powder coating allows colors such as silver, white, black, champagne, and brown. The right finish depends on whether the profile is used indoors, outdoors, or in decorative or structural settings.

How is angle aluminum profile packed for export shipments?

Common export packing includes EPE and paper wrapping, plastic film wrapping, protective film plus heat shrink film, and factory standard export packing. Packing choice depends on profile length, surface finish, and transport mode, since polished and anodized surfaces scratch more easily. Buyers can request reinforced packing for long lengths or mixed-container shipments.
